How Much Does a Master’s in Business Administration from Gratz College Cost?

$17,042 Average Tuition and Fees

Gratz College Graduate Tuition and Fees

During the 2019-2020 academic year, part-time graduate students at Gratz College paid an average of $0 per credit hour. No discount was available for in-state students. The average full-time tuition and fees for graduate students are shown in the table below.

In StateOut of State
Tuition$16,452$16,452
Fees$590$590

Gratz College Master’s Student Diversity for Business Administration

5 Master's Degrees Awarded
60.0% Women
In the 2019-2020 academic year, 5 students received their master’s degree in business administration. The gender and racial-ethnic breakdown of those individuals is shown below.

Male-to-Female Ratio

Of the students who received their master’s degree in business administration in 2019-2020, 60.0% of them were women. This is higher than the nationwide number of 48.5%.
